Nom original: Offentlighets- och sekretessförordning (2009:641).
Nom: Public Access to Information and Secrecy Ordinance (2009:641).
Pays: Suède
Sujet(s): Dispositions générales
Type de loi: Règlement, Décret, Arrêté, Ordonnance
Adopté le: 2009-05-28

Résumé/Citation: The consolidation of the Ordinance includes a total of 85 amending text through October 2018 (up to Ordinance 2018:1526). The consolidated text includes various amendments.

Contains 12 articles and 21 sections concerning, inter alia:

Section 1: Regulations on the basis of Chapter 2. 14§ Freedom of the Press Act (1949:105).
Section 2: Provisions under Chapter 5. §3 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 3: Energy Markets Inspectorate, statements included in the system of information about transactions.
Section 4: Provisions pursuant to Chapter 5. §4 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 5: Regulations under the Chapter 15. §2 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 6: Regulations under the Chapter 21. §3 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 7: Regulations under the Chapter 22. §1 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 8: National Tax Agency's database of identity cards register in Sweden.
Section 9: National Board of Health register of health professionals.
Section 10: National Occupational Pensions Board register.
Section 11: National Defense Agency Recruitment official register of defense personnel.
Section 12: Regulations under the Chapter 24. §8 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 13: Agency for Cultural Analysis, studies on children and youth culture, habits, studies on threats to cultural practitioners.
Section 14: Higher Education Council, surveys on students' living conditions.
Section 15: Regulations under the Chapter 30. §7 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 16: Regulations under the Chapter 30. §23 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 17: Regulations under the Chapter 38. §8a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 18: Regulations under the Chapter 39. §3 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 19: Regulations under the Chapter 39. §5b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 20: Regulations under the Chapter 42. §10 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
Section 21: Regulations under the Chapter 43. §7 Public Access to Information and Secrecy Act (2009:400).
